When the data tells something unusual, I listen. And the 47.83 of Tatsuya Murasa at the 102nd Japanese Intercollegiate Swimming Championships is exactly that kind of signal. A 19-year-old from Chuo University just shattered the Japanese national record in the 100m freestyle — a milestone that even the most seasoned analysts cannot ignore.

On September 6, 2026, at the 50m pool in Osaka, Murasa led off the 4x100m freestyle relay for Chuo University. The clock stopped at 47.83 — 0.02 seconds faster than the previous national record of 47.85 set by Katsuhiro Matsumoto at the 2026 Japanese Swimming Championships. This was the second national record in two days at the meet, and the second individual record Murasa now holds, alongside the 200m freestyle record of 1:44.54 — a time that earned him a bronze medal at the 2026 World Championships.

Before this competition, Murasa's lifetime best in the 100m freestyle was 48.43. Cutting 0.60 seconds in approximately 8 months is a significant jump, but well within the physiological capability of a 19-year-old male swimmer undergoing physical and technical development.

Numbers speak louder than emotions. Murasa's splits in the 47.83 swim were 22.91 for the first 50m and 24.92 for the second 50m. The 2.01-second differential between the two halves is notable — significantly larger than the 1.2-1.8 second differential typically seen among world-class sprint freestylers.

This reveals a front-loaded pacing structure — Murasa pushes extremely hard in the first 50m, but his speed drops considerably in the second half. Two interpretations exist: first, a deliberate tactic — maximizing early speed in a relay lead-off context; second, a technical weakness — Murasa's swimming efficiency deteriorates under fatigue in the back half of the race.

My experience tracking sprint races tells me this weakness could be exploited in head-to-head racing. Swimmers with better back-half maintenance — like Pan Zhanle with his world record of 46.80 — could overtake Murasa in the final 25m. This is a technical warning signal that Murasa's coaching staff needs to address.

With 47.83, Murasa becomes the third Japanese man in history to break the 48-second barrier in the 100m freestyle, and the fourth-fastest Asian in history. However, the 1.03-second gap to Pan Zhanle's world record is significant — it represents the distance between a continental-level swimmer and an absolute world-class performer.

My data model indicates that to compete for medals at the Olympic level, Murasa needs to bring his time under 47.5 seconds — a feasible target but one that requires significant improvement in the back half. If he can improve his closing 50m split from 24.92 to 24.5, his overall time could drop to 47.4 — competitive at the Asian and world level.

There is a critical tactical blind spot that many overlook: the 47.83 was set in a relay lead-off context, not an individual race. Relay contexts can create a psychological advantage — swimmers often swim faster knowing teammates are behind them. Conversely, the pressure of an individual race at a major international meet is entirely different.

Correlation is not causation. Murasa's 47.83 in a relay context does not automatically translate to the same time in an individual race. Swimming history has seen many cases where swimmers swim 0.2-0.3 seconds faster in relay contexts than individual races. This means Murasa's "true" individual 100m freestyle time may be in the 48.0-48.1 range — still excellent, but not as groundbreaking as 47.83.

Additionally, the 0.60-second improvement in 8 months is a significant jump. Being right too early is also a form of rejection — if Murasa cannot replicate this performance at subsequent meets, experts will question the stability of this breakthrough.

One underappreciated aspect: Murasa now holds both Japanese national records in the 100m and 200m freestyle. This dual-event capability is extremely rare and makes him an invaluable asset for Japanese relay teams. He can swim lead-off or anchor in all three relay events: 4x100m freestyle, 4x200m freestyle, and potentially the freestyle leg of the medley relay.

The relay record of 3:14.83 set by Chuo University at this meet further reinforces the argument that Murasa is the centerpiece of Japan's relay strategy for the 2028 Olympic cycle. If Japan wants to compete for relay medals at Los Angeles 2028, Murasa is indispensable.
